Buckwheat (recipes)


A type of grain used extensively in Eastern European Cooking. Buckwheat flour is traditionally used to make blinis - small pancakes eaten with caviar. In Italy it' s sometimes used to make gnocchi; buckwheat pasta is the basis of the famous pizzocheri, a northern Italian dish traditionally made with potatoes, cabbage and cheese.Buckwheat can be purchased from larger supermarkets or Health-Food shops.Buckwheat pancakes
